2026/03/19 15:08:41 Registering 2 clients 2026/03/19 15:08:41 Registering 3 informer factories 2026/03/19 15:08:41 Registering 3 informers 2026/03/19 15:08:41 Registering 2 controllers {"level":"info","ts":"2026-03-19T15:08:41.908Z","logger":"pipelines-as-code-webhook","caller":"profiling/server.go:65","msg":"Profiling enabled: false","commit":"6e99cac"} {"level":"info","ts":"2026-03-19T15:08:41.910Z","logger":"pipelines-as-code-webhook","caller":"leaderelection/context.go:47","msg":"Running with Standard leader election","commit":"6e99cac"} {"level":"info","ts":"2026-03-19T15:08:41.912Z","logger":"pipelines-as-code-webhook","caller":"sharedmain/main.go:282","msg":"Starting configuration manager...","commit":"6e99cac"} {"level":"info","ts":1773932922.0135896,"logger":"fallback","caller":"injection/injection.go:63","msg":"Starting informers..."} {"level":"info","ts":"2026-03-19T15:08:42.114Z","logger":"pipelines-as-code-webhook","caller":"webhook/webhook.go:246","msg":"Informers have been synced, unblocking admission webhooks.","commit":"6e99cac"} {"level":"info","ts":"2026-03-19T15:08:42.114Z","logger":"pipelines-as-code-webhook","caller":"sharedmain/main.go:315","msg":"Starting controllers...","commit":"6e99cac"} {"level":"info","ts":"2026-03-19T15:08:42.114Z","logger":"pipelines-as-code-webhook","caller":"injection/health_check.go:43","msg":"Probes server listening on port 8080","commit":"6e99cac"} {"level":"info","ts":"2026-03-19T15:08:42.114Z","logger":"pipelines-as-code-webhook","caller":"leaderelection/context.go:147","msg":"pipelines-as-code-webhook.validationwebhook.00-of-01 will run in leader-elected mode with id \"pipelines-as-code-webhook-f7b45c7ff-6tpjz_e475b060-41f5-4ab8-a1d2-c3c857aac9ea\"","commit":"6e99cac"} {"level":"info","ts":"2026-03-19T15:08:42.114Z","logger":"pipelines-as-code-webhook.ValidationWebhook","caller":"controller/controller.go:484","msg":"Starting controller and workers","commit":"6e99cac"} {"level":"info","ts":"2026-03-19T15:08:42.114Z","logger":"pipelines-as-code-webhook.ValidationWebhook","caller":"controller/controller.go:494","msg":"Started workers","commit":"6e99cac"} {"level":"info","ts":"2026-03-19T15:08:42.114Z","logger":"pipelines-as-code-webhook.ValidationWebhook","caller":"controller/controller.go:548","msg":"Reconcile succeeded","commit":"6e99cac","knative.dev/traceid":"8782bbb7-e746-47a8-942d-916309fc8aab","knative.dev/key":"pipelines-as-code/pipelines-as-code-webhook-certs","duration":0.00000928} {"level":"info","ts":"2026-03-19T15:08:42.114Z","logger":"pipelines-as-code-webhook.ValidationWebhook","caller":"controller/controller.go:548","msg":"Reconcile succeeded","commit":"6e99cac","knative.dev/traceid":"8861cd70-3d89-4940-9ed9-ab32abd7df40","knative.dev/key":"validation.pipelinesascode.tekton.dev","duration":0.0000036} {"level":"info","ts":"2026-03-19T15:08:42.114Z","logger":"pipelines-as-code-webhook","caller":"leaderelection/context.go:147","msg":"pipelines-as-code-webhook.webhookcertificates.00-of-01 will run in leader-elected mode with id \"pipelines-as-code-webhook-f7b45c7ff-6tpjz_4fb73d79-c8b2-4a10-851f-684875475d93\"","commit":"6e99cac"} {"level":"info","ts":"2026-03-19T15:08:42.114Z","logger":"pipelines-as-code-webhook.WebhookCertificates","caller":"controller/controller.go:484","msg":"Starting controller and workers","commit":"6e99cac"} {"level":"info","ts":"2026-03-19T15:08:42.114Z","logger":"pipelines-as-code-webhook.WebhookCertificates","caller":"controller/controller.go:494","msg":"Started workers","commit":"6e99cac"} I0319 15:08:42.115043 1 leaderelection.go:257] attempting to acquire leader lease pipelines-as-code/pipelines-as-code-webhook.validationwebhook.00-of-01... I0319 15:08:42.115277 1 leaderelection.go:257] attempting to acquire leader lease pipelines-as-code/pipelines-as-code-webhook.webhookcertificates.00-of-01... I0319 15:08:42.119450 1 leaderelection.go:271] successfully acquired lease pipelines-as-code/pipelines-as-code-webhook.webhookcertificates.00-of-01 {"level":"info","ts":"2026-03-19T15:08:42.119Z","logger":"pipelines-as-code-webhook","caller":"leaderelection/context.go:156","msg":"\"pipelines-as-code-webhook-f7b45c7ff-6tpjz_4fb73d79-c8b2-4a10-851f-684875475d93\" has started leading \"pipelines-as-code-webhook.webhookcertificates.00-of-01\"","commit":"6e99cac"} {"level":"info","ts":"2026-03-19T15:08:42.119Z","logger":"pipelines-as-code-webhook.WebhookCertificates","caller":"certificates/certificates.go:80","msg":"Certificate secret \"pipelines-as-code-webhook-certs\" is missing key \"server-key.pem\"","commit":"6e99cac","knative.dev/traceid":"c6a6ffd9-8666-4d55-a1c1-d4e25ee51f75","knative.dev/key":"pipelines-as-code/pipelines-as-code-webhook-certs"} I0319 15:08:42.121330 1 leaderelection.go:271] successfully acquired lease pipelines-as-code/pipelines-as-code-webhook.validationwebhook.00-of-01 {"level":"info","ts":"2026-03-19T15:08:42.121Z","logger":"pipelines-as-code-webhook","caller":"leaderelection/context.go:156","msg":"\"pipelines-as-code-webhook-f7b45c7ff-6tpjz_e475b060-41f5-4ab8-a1d2-c3c857aac9ea\" has started leading \"pipelines-as-code-webhook.validationwebhook.00-of-01\"","commit":"6e99cac"} {"level":"error","ts":"2026-03-19T15:08:42.121Z","logger":"pipelines-as-code-webhook.ValidationWebhook","caller":"controller/controller.go:564","msg":"Reconcile error","commit":"6e99cac","knative.dev/traceid":"7c8d2754-0a64-44a2-ad8c-bef9a2632778","knative.dev/key":"validation.pipelinesascode.tekton.dev","duration":0.00001016,"error":"secret \"pipelines-as-code-webhook-certs\" is missing \"ca-cert.pem\" key","stacktrace":"knative.dev/pkg/controller.(*Impl).handleErr\n\tknative.dev/pkg@v0.0.0-20260114161248-8c840449eed2/controller/controller.go:564\nknative.dev/pkg/controller.(*Impl).processNextWorkItem\n\tknative.dev/pkg@v0.0.0-20260114161248-8c840449eed2/controller/controller.go:541\nknative.dev/pkg/controller.(*Impl).RunContext.func3\n\tknative.dev/pkg@v0.0.0-20260114161248-8c840449eed2/controller/controller.go:489"} {"level":"info","ts":"2026-03-19T15:08:42.126Z","logger":"pipelines-as-code-webhook.ValidationWebhook","caller":"webhook/reconciler.go:121","msg":"Updating webhook","commit":"6e99cac","knative.dev/traceid":"a341b112-56be-4e6d-a397-c2ea7af0d3e9","knative.dev/key":"pipelines-as-code/pipelines-as-code-webhook-certs"} {"level":"info","ts":"2026-03-19T15:08:42.127Z","logger":"pipelines-as-code-webhook.ValidationWebhook","caller":"webhook/reconciler.go:121","msg":"Updating webhook","commit":"6e99cac","knative.dev/traceid":"e0b7cfd7-d09e-42c2-8600-58ababc78175","knative.dev/key":"validation.pipelinesascode.tekton.dev"} {"level":"info","ts":"2026-03-19T15:08:42.127Z","logger":"pipelines-as-code-webhook.WebhookCertificates","caller":"controller/controller.go:548","msg":"Reconcile succeeded","commit":"6e99cac","knative.dev/traceid":"c6a6ffd9-8666-4d55-a1c1-d4e25ee51f75","knative.dev/key":"pipelines-as-code/pipelines-as-code-webhook-certs","duration":0.008218689} {"level":"info","ts":"2026-03-19T15:08:42.128Z","logger":"pipelines-as-code-webhook.WebhookCertificates","caller":"controller/controller.go:548","msg":"Reconcile succeeded","commit":"6e99cac","knative.dev/traceid":"5424e93c-a52a-433b-88f7-dccadc754a35","knative.dev/key":"pipelines-as-code/pipelines-as-code-webhook-certs","duration":0.000085872} {"level":"info","ts":"2026-03-19T15:08:42.131Z","logger":"pipelines-as-code-webhook.ValidationWebhook","caller":"controller/controller.go:548","msg":"Reconcile succeeded","commit":"6e99cac","knative.dev/traceid":"e0b7cfd7-d09e-42c2-8600-58ababc78175","knative.dev/key":"validation.pipelinesascode.tekton.dev","duration":0.004875271} {"level":"info","ts":"2026-03-19T15:08:42.135Z","logger":"pipelines-as-code-webhook.ValidationWebhook","caller":"webhook/reconciler.go:121","msg":"Updating webhook","commit":"6e99cac","knative.dev/traceid":"ce801676-f942-4724-a69c-b8b9142987fa","knative.dev/key":"validation.pipelinesascode.tekton.dev"} {"level":"error","ts":"2026-03-19T15:08:42.136Z","logger":"pipelines-as-code-webhook.ValidationWebhook","caller":"controller/controller.go:564","msg":"Reconcile error","commit":"6e99cac","knative.dev/traceid":"a341b112-56be-4e6d-a397-c2ea7af0d3e9","knative.dev/key":"pipelines-as-code/pipelines-as-code-webhook-certs","duration":0.010626038,"error":"failed to update webhook: Operation cannot be fulfilled on validatingwebhookconfigurations.admissionregistration.k8s.io \"validation.pipelinesascode.tekton.dev\": the object has been modified; please apply your changes to the latest version and try again","stacktrace":"knative.dev/pkg/controller.(*Impl).handleErr\n\tknative.dev/pkg@v0.0.0-20260114161248-8c840449eed2/controller/controller.go:564\nknative.dev/pkg/controller.(*Impl).processNextWorkItem\n\tknative.dev/pkg@v0.0.0-20260114161248-8c840449eed2/controller/controller.go:541\nknative.dev/pkg/controller.(*Impl).RunContext.func3\n\tknative.dev/pkg@v0.0.0-20260114161248-8c840449eed2/controller/controller.go:489"} {"level":"info","ts":"2026-03-19T15:08:42.213Z","logger":"pipelines-as-code-webhook.ValidationWebhook","caller":"webhook/reconciler.go:121","msg":"Updating webhook","commit":"6e99cac","knative.dev/traceid":"66ed9724-cbf4-457f-9688-cbf3ae04382b","knative.dev/key":"pipelines-as-code/pipelines-as-code-webhook-certs"} {"level":"info","ts":"2026-03-19T15:08:42.213Z","logger":"pipelines-as-code-webhook.ValidationWebhook","caller":"controller/controller.go:548","msg":"Reconcile succeeded","commit":"6e99cac","knative.dev/traceid":"ce801676-f942-4724-a69c-b8b9142987fa","knative.dev/key":"validation.pipelinesascode.tekton.dev","duration":0.081750011} {"level":"info","ts":"2026-03-19T15:08:42.215Z","logger":"pipelines-as-code-webhook.ValidationWebhook","caller":"controller/controller.go:548","msg":"Reconcile succeeded","commit":"6e99cac","knative.dev/traceid":"66ed9724-cbf4-457f-9688-cbf3ae04382b","knative.dev/key":"pipelines-as-code/pipelines-as-code-webhook-certs","duration":0.006445823}